How I picked the best gaming desk

When picking these suggestions, I drew on the advice of hardware and computing experts — cited further down in this guide — as well as my own experience as a gadget reporter and kept the below criteria in mind:

  • Multifunctionality: The average office desk can act as a gaming desk and vice versa. But, when assessing the best gaming desks for this guide, I kept in mind what models would serve a variety of purposes with ease.
  • Adjustable height: Gamers need to be able to adjust the setup of their desk so that they are gaming in complete comfort, no matter their height — being able to tweak the position of the desk is important for both comfort and the ability to use it as a standing desk in certain situations.
  • Cable and space management: A gaming desk is likely to house a number of different devices and accessories, so it’s crucial that there’s space for all of your gadgets, and ideally a number of good cable management features — cable trays or fastening straps — to keep everything in order.

How to shop for the best gaming desk

Mason advises shoppers that “There are three main considerations when choosing the right gaming desk: size, bearing weight, and feature set.”

  • Size: “If you don’t have enough space for the one you want,” says Mason, “there’s simply no way to make it work beyond going smaller. Always measure twice and remember to include enough room for your gaming chair. 
  • Bearing weight: “Most desks are sturdy enough to hold two monitors and your usual peripherals, but numbers matter if you plan to stick a fully-fledged gaming PC on top of it,” says Mason. “Make sure to check its holding weight against your equipment before buying.”
  • Features: Mason also says, “It’s important to consider the kinds of features you want. If you choose a regular standing desk, there’s usually no way to make it adjustable in the future. Should you want a standing desk, it’s worth investing in it outright.”

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does a gaming desk cost?

Gaming desks range widely in price, depending on how complex, large and stylish you need it to be. Van der Velde advises that “Simple, no frills gaming desks come in as low as $70, while the fancier, flashier ones go for over $1,000.”

The key, van der Velde says, is to “Figure out what your needs are first. Do you have three monitors as well as a streaming setup? If so, you'll need more space for all that gear. Do you just have one or two screens and want a comfy desk with a cup holder? If so, you don't need to break the bank. And if a standard office desk is the best fit for you, get it and then decorate and customize it however suits your playstyle best.”

What’s the difference between a gaming desk and a computer desk?

If you have an existing desk, you may wonder if you need a dedicated gaming replacement. “The truth is any desk can be a gaming desk if you need it to be,” says van der Velde. “A big difference is gaming desks are usually more open, with fewer closed drawers and cabinets.”

Van der Velde adds, “Typically, gaming desks will come with open but built-in storage space for accessories like headphones, controllers and maybe even a console. A shelf to keep your PC tower off the ground is also good because this will protect it from any spills.” If the gaming desk of your dreams is out of your budget, Van der Velde recommends looking for more affordable accessories you can just clip on or pop on your desk, like a detachable keyboard tray or headphone hook or cupholder.

Is an IKEA desk good for gaming?

This depends on the desk – but IKEA does sell dedicated gaming desks, and according to the brand, “Many of our gaming table styles were designed in collaboration with the experts at Republic of Gamers (ROG),” a hardware line from Asus that makes gaming PCs and laptops.
